Transaction 81ee79a56faf120ce214e56483bab76bb3fa9ed497ecfadcc904b3a8cb39b153

1 Input
2 Outputs
  • 81ee79a56faf120ce214e56483bab76bb3fa9ed497ecfadcc904b3a8cb39b153:0
  • value  17656935
    address  3HHoFjdGqA1DZr3pdczpwe1Nc2LSx8caXo
  • 81ee79a56faf120ce214e56483bab76bb3fa9ed497ecfadcc904b3a8cb39b153:1
  • value  250242
    address  1JoXcZdyMKKxgMTCHaGKyhq8TkgdNWMGuf